My first experiment with aegisub, a software for subtitling. I’m a complete n00b here, so I have no idea how to do those fancy animated subtitle. All I could do was experimenting with the karaoke feature, since it is built-in to the program.

Youtube version:

Once I competed the subtitle using aegisub, there was the challenge on how to create a hard-sub on the video. Aegisub standard output is .ass file. It allows you to export it to .srt, but you lose all the formatting, fonts, karaoke, and color, so that is useless. I thought of using handbrake, but handbrake only supports .srt for its subtitle input. After digging around further, finally I stumbled upon a program called avidemux. Actually, I was somewhat familiar with this program in the past for transcoding videos. Lo and behold, it has a filter to apply a .ass subtitle file on a video. Alas, it is Windows only, but it works. πŸ™‚

Ever wonder how the fansubbers do those fancy karaoke subs? Me too. By chance, I actually found somebody subbing one of my AMVs! LOL.

Here’s the original:

Well, from that person’s video title, he/she mentioned Aegisub. Lo and behold, it’s a program specifically made for creating subtitles. It’s available for PC and Mac. I’ll be playing around with this program. Making subtitles manually on iMovie/Final Cut is really time consuming. We’ll see if I learn it good enough to create those fancy subtitles. πŸ˜€
